Define Your Values

The first step to ethical savings is to get clear about your values. What matters most to you? Is it environmental sustainability, social justice, or supporting local businesses? Identifying your core values will help you make informed decisions about where to put your hard-earned money.

For example, if you’re passionate about environmental sustainability, you might choose to invest in companies that prioritize eco-friendly practices or opt for a green savings account offered by a bank committed to reducing its carbon footprint.

Set Clear Savings Goals

Once you’ve nailed down your values, it’s time to set some clear savings goals. Having a specific target in mind will motivate you to save while ensuring that your money is being allocated purposefully.

Imagine you’re passionate about supporting local businesses. You might decide to allocate a certain percentage of your savings toward shopping at local stores rather than big-box retailers. Setting a monthly or yearly savings goal for this purpose will keep you on track.

Avoid the Temptation of Impulse Purchases

Ah, impulse purchases – the Achilles’ heel of ethical spenders everywhere. It’s all too easy to succumb to the siren song of that shiny new gadget or the allure of a trendy wardrobe update. But remember, ethical savings often means saying no to these temptations.

Next time you find yourself itching to buy something on impulse, take a moment to reflect. Ask yourself if this purchase aligns with your values and savings goals. If not, consider redirecting that money toward something that does.

Shop Smart and Support Ethical Brands

When it comes to managing your savings with moral integrity, the choices you make in the marketplace are crucial. Seek out brands and products that align with your values. Look for certifications like Fair Trade, organic, or cruelty-free to guide your purchases.

For instance, if you’re passionate about fair labor practices, opt for clothing brands that pay their workers a living wage and ensure safe working conditions. By supporting such brands, you’re not only dressing ethically but also contributing to a more just society.

Consider Ethical Investing

If you have some extra funds to invest, why not explore ethical investment options? Ethical investment portfolios focus on companies that adhere to responsible business practices. They allow you to grow your wealth while supporting businesses that share your values.

Investing ethically doesn’t mean sacrificing returns. In fact, studies have shown that ethical investment portfolios can perform just as well, if not better, than traditional ones. So, it’s a win-win situation for your wallet and your conscience.

Automate Your Savings

To make ethical savings a habit, consider automating the process. Set up automatic transfers from your checking account to your savings or investment accounts. This ensures that you consistently put money toward your goals without the temptation to spend it elsewhere.

By automating your savings, you’ll find it easier to adhere to your ethical spending plan, as the money is allocated before you even see it in your checking account.

Reevaluate and Adjust

Life is fluid, and so are our values and goals. Periodically revisit your savings plan to ensure it remains in sync with your evolving principles. You might find that your priorities shift over time, leading you to adjust your savings goals and where you choose to allocate your funds.

For example, if you become more focused on supporting education in underprivileged communities, you can redirect a portion of your savings to organizations or initiatives that align with this newfound passion.
